I have two Qantas club complimentary lounge passes from ANZ but after reading the back of the passes i don't know if I would be let in as it says it must be on a Qantas flight Number and my flights are with Cathay ( oneworld ) The itinerary is on my Qantas F,F site as the points will be credited to Qantas. I did ask the ANZ receptionist about this and she seemed to think it would be ok, but sometimes getting to the lounge can be quite an ordeal if the door person has had a bad day, Has any members had this problem and what advice can anyone give me.
Thank you
dav12643ies
 
I don't know of any QF codeshare on a CX flight so I dont think you could use it. You likely have a CX flight no. Even if it shows up on your QFF profile and are crediting to QF that important QF flight number would be missing.

Sorry to disappoint.

However your anz black will get you 2 free entires into the amex lounge in Sydney if that is your outward port.

Fyi if you looking to now offload the QF passes i will happily take them of your hands. Have some flights in July on QF.
 
So you can't use the Qantas passes, but can access the Amex a Lounge with your Black Amex (with a guest)
